Research Abstract |
Anaerobic ammonium oxidation(anammox) is a novel and promising process for the removal of inorganic nitrogen from wastewater treatment. In this study, I have characterized a heterodimeric heme-protein with a low molecular weight being specific for anammox bacteria to reveal the reaction mechanism of anammox. Biochemical analyses revealed that the heterodimeric heme-protein was involved in the hydrazine synthesis which is a key reaction in anammox process.
